These strategies help the educator teach reading in motivating and engaging ways. Covers
phonemic awareness, comprehension, writing strategically, creating and discussing texts, and much more!

About the Author
Marcia L. Tate is the executive director of professional development for the DeKalb County School System, Decatur, Georgia. During her 28-year career with the district, Tate has been a classroom teacher, reading specialist, language arts coordinator, and staff development director. As an educational consultant, she has presented to over 50,000 administrators, teachers, parents, and business and community leaders throughout the United States.
